Keyword Intent Mapping: Route Queries to the Decision Each Page Must Support
A keyword is an observed expression; keyword intent is an interpretation of the task behind it. Mapping turns that interpretation into a page decision: which query cluster belongs to which page, what decision the page must support, what format can carry the evidence, and what the visitor should be able to do next. Live results, existing page ownership, and dated performance evidence keep that decision open to correction.
Google describes the first relevance problem as establishing what someone is looking for—the intent behind the query. Its systems consider the words used and context such as language, location, and freshness needs, then assess relevant content beyond exact-word repetition. That account does not supply a page-planning method; it explains why the query alone cannot settle the page job.
Keyword intent, search intent, query intent, and user intent usually name the same underlying concept. Ahrefs makes a useful workflow distinction: keyword intent informs whether a query belongs in the strategy, while search intent informs how a page aligns with the result landscape. Here, “keyword intent” names the interpreted research signal; “page decision” names the job the site elects to support.
That is separate from Google Ads match type. Broad, phrase, and exact match control which searches can make an ad eligible; they do not classify the organic page a searcher needs. It is also separate from a buyer-journey stage. A query exposes an immediate task with imperfect context. It does not prove where the person sits in a funnel, whether a purchase will happen, or whether every person using the query shares one motive.
The four labels are a starting vocabulary, not the map
SEO practice commonly uses four broad intent categories:
| Intent label | Immediate task | Result or page shapes often associated with it | Decision the page may need to support |
|---|---|---|---|
| Informational | Learn, understand, diagnose, or complete a method | Explanations, guides, reference pages, calculators, videos | “Do I understand this well enough to apply or troubleshoot it?” |
| Navigational | Reach a known site, brand, product, or page | Homepages, login pages, documentation, branded destinations | “Is this the correct destination, and can I reach it directly?” |
| Commercial investigation | Compare options before choosing | Comparisons, alternatives, reviews, category pages, use-case pages | “Which option fits my criteria, constraints, and trade-offs?” |
| Transactional | Complete an action | Product, pricing, signup, booking, download, or checkout pages | “Can I take the intended action with enough confidence and little friction?” |
A label is shorthand, not a page specification. “Informational” can describe a two-sentence definition, a diagnostic branch, a calculator, or a long implementation guide. Those pages support different decisions even when a tool gives every query the same letter. Local intent can produce maps and location-oriented results that demand a different surface from a standard article or product page.
A query can carry more than one intent. Semrush calls a result set containing materially different purposes fractured intent. Record the dominant task only when the observed results justify one; otherwise preserve a primary and a meaningful secondary interpretation. Flattening a mixed SERP into one confident label discards the very evidence the map is meant to retain.
Semrush documents a machine-learning classification informed by SERP features, intent-indicating words, and branded status. Ahrefs offers a different result-level analysis. Because vendor classifications encode different methods, the map must retain the observed result pattern and the editor’s reasoning instead of treating a tool label as the page decision.
The practical replacement for a score is a sentence:
For this query cluster, the page must help the searcher make or complete this specific decision, using this evidence, before offering this next action.
If a team cannot fill that sentence without vague words such as “engage,” “convert,” or “learn more,” the query is not ready for page routing.
1. A query-to-surface inventory defines the available evidence
The full query set and the site’s existing pages establish the starting field; a preselected list of article ideas hides both unclaimed demand and current ownership. A useful working inventory includes:
- the raw query and its data source;
- locale, language, device, and observation date;
- search volume with its source and period, if available;
- the current or proposed URL;
- any existing query-to-page performance;
- the business area able to answer the task; and
- an explicit status: investigate, map, defer, or decline.
For an existing site, Google Search Console supplies observed query-to-page evidence. Its Performance report lists queries that bring traffic and, after filtering to one query, shows which URLs appeared. The dataset has reporting limits and does not reveal private motives, but it does expose whether Search currently associates a query with the page the team expected.
Do not force every row into a publishing queue. “No target” is a valid routing decision when the task is outside your product, expertise, audience, or ability to satisfy it. A high-volume query with no credible page job is demand you observed, not work you are obliged to accept.
2. The live result set exposes the task and delivery pattern
Query wording gives you a hypothesis. Modifiers such as “what is,” “best,” “versus,” “pricing,” “login,” and “near me” often narrow the task, but ambiguous nouns and short queries can conceal several interpretations. Review the current result set in the locale and device you intend to serve, and date the observation.
For each priority query, record five things:
- Page type: article, product page, category, comparison, tool, video, forum, documentation, or another surface.
- Format: definition, tutorial, list, alternatives review, calculator, template, directory, or direct action.
- Angle: beginner, technical, industry-specific, low-cost, fast, local, current, or another repeated emphasis.
- SERP features: videos, maps, product units, People Also Ask, snippets, or other result modules that reveal adjacent tasks.
- Distribution: whether one task clearly dominates or several page jobs have meaningful representation.
Open the ranking pages. A title that looks like a guide may lead to an interactive tool; a category label may hide a comparison experience. Semrush’s SERP-analysis guidance similarly recommends examining format, topics, structure, and missing information rather than stopping at the result title.
Preserve the locale, device, observation date, result formats, and intended-audience task with the snapshot. Google’s people-first guidance judges the page by whether that audience can leave having learned enough to achieve its goal, and explicitly rejects a preferred word count.
3. A decision statement fixes the page job
The page job begins with the state the searcher needs to leave in, not with a preferred page type.
Weak: “Educate users about revenue attribution.”
Stronger: “Help a growth lead decide which attribution question can be answered with the available data, which model assumptions remain, and whether the result is fit for a budget decision.”
The stronger version tells an editor what evidence belongs on the page and what must be excluded. It also prevents “informational” from defaulting to “blog post” before the task establishes whether the useful surface is a definition, diagnostic, comparison, calculator, or implementation procedure.
A complete page decision statement has four parts:
| Part | Question |
|---|---|
| Entry state | What does the searcher already know or appear to be trying to resolve? |
| Exit decision | What should the visitor be able to decide, understand, reach, or do? |
| Required evidence | What definitions, comparisons, proof, inputs, limits, or steps make that decision responsible? |
| Next action | What is the nearest logical action after the task is complete? |
The next action is not automatically a demo request. An informational page may point to a worksheet or a deeper method. A comparison page may lead to requirements gathering. A transactional page may need to remove friction and expose terms before asking for commitment. A navigational page should usually get out of the way and deliver the expected destination.
4. Shared task and SERP overlap define the cluster
Group queries when one page can satisfy them with the same core answer, proof, and next action. Similar wording alone is not enough. The same four-category label is not enough either.
Two queries belong together when:
- their current result sets substantially favor the same kinds of pages;
- the searcher would leave both searches having made the same decision;
- one page can answer both without changing its primary format or CTA; and
- neither query introduces a material audience, location, freshness, or product constraint.
Ahrefs describes keyword clustering as grouping by intent and SERP overlap, then keyword mapping as assigning those clusters to pages. The sequence matters: phrasings must represent one task before that task receives a URL.
The clustering record should preserve the actual overlap, result diversity, branded destinations, local modules, SERP volatility, and the written reason for the judgment. Those observations let another editor challenge the grouping when a repeated set of results is less stable or uniform than a percentage suggests.
The inverse rule matters just as much: split queries when the decision changes, even if the nouns are identical. “What is a customer data platform,” “customer data platform comparison,” and “customer data platform demo” all share a topic. They ask for a category explanation, an evaluation, and an action. One oversized page can mention all three, but it cannot give all three equal priority without blurring its job.
5. Each cluster needs one explicit route
A task-level cluster earns a route only after the existing site is inspected. The route is a content decision, not an automatic command to publish.
| Observed condition | Route | Evidence required |
|---|---|---|
| An existing page supports the same decision and already appears for the cluster | Keep ownership there; update only the missing evidence or experience | Current page task, result snapshot, and query-to-page data |
| An existing page is relevant by topic but supports a different decision | Differentiate the jobs or choose a more suitable owner | Distinct exit decisions, formats, and next actions |
| No page supports the task, and the task fits the site’s audience and offer | Plan a new page | Business fit, unique page job, required evidence, and owner |
| Several pages support materially the same task | Investigate overlap; consolidate only when evidence supports it | Same-intent analysis plus performance and page-value evidence |
| One broad query shows durable mixed intent | Choose a primary task aligned with the site, preserve secondary intent, and set a review trigger | Result distribution, business fit, and format compatibility |
| The task belongs to another brand or a surface the site cannot credibly provide | Decline or leave unassigned | Scope reason, not a substitute page invented for traffic |
Multiple pages appearing for one query do not automatically prove harmful cannibalization. Ahrefs recommends looking for pages that fulfill the same or very similar intent and evidence that the overlap impairs organic performance. Pages serving different tasks can legitimately coexist for a broad, mixed-intent query.
This is why “one keyword, one page” is too crude. The safer operating rule is one accountable page job per decision cluster. One page can own many phrasings of that job. One broad query may touch more than one legitimate page job. The map should make those boundaries visible rather than pretending the underlying demand is tidier than it is.
6. The intent map becomes the production contract
An intent map can live in a spreadsheet, database, or repository file. Its production value comes from explicit fields and ownership, with one row per decision cluster rather than one row per exported keyword.
| Field | What to record |
|---|---|
| Cluster ID | A stable identifier that survives changes to the representative query |
| Representative query | The clearest query used to name the cluster |
| Supporting queries | Phrasings that share the same task and can be served by one page |
| SERP context | Locale, language, device, observation date, and result notes |
| Intent evidence | Dominant and secondary intent, page types, formats, angles, features, and uncertainty |
| Decision statement | The specific decision or action the page must support |
| Required evidence | Definitions, steps, comparisons, inputs, limits, or proof the page must contain |
| Target surface | Existing URL, approved planned page, or explicit no-target status |
| Page shape | The format and interaction that can deliver the required evidence |
| Next action | The logical CTA or handoff after the page task is complete |
| Ownership | The person or team responsible for the page and the mapping decision |
| Review trigger | The change in SERPs, product scope, or performance that requires reassessment |
Do not hide uncertainty in a numeric confidence score unless your organization has defined and calibrated one. A short evidence note is more auditable: “mixed comparison and product results; commercial task chosen because the site can support neutral evaluation; review if product pages become dominant.” Another operator can inspect and revise that judgment.
An illustrative mapping pass
The following example is deliberately generic. It is not a claim about today’s results for these queries; assume a dated SERP review has confirmed the patterns shown.
| Query cluster | Observed pattern in the example | Page decision | Route | Next action |
|---|---|---|---|---|
| “what is revenue attribution” and definition variants | Explanations and method overviews | Understand what the concept measures, which assumptions it contains, and what it cannot prove | Existing educational guide | Continue to a model-selection worksheet |
| “revenue attribution models” and comparison variants | Model comparisons and frameworks | Compare model assumptions and choose a method fit for the available data and decision | Planned comparison guide | Document selection criteria |
| “revenue attribution software” and category variants | Category and product-evaluation pages | Decide whether software is needed and which requirements form a credible shortlist | Existing solution-category page, if it can compare honestly | Build a requirements list |
| “revenue attribution software demo” and action variants | Product and conversion surfaces | Start a product evaluation with clear expectations about the demonstration | Transactional landing page | Request or schedule the evaluation |
The topic stays constant while the exit decision changes. Combining every row into one “ultimate guide” would force one page to educate, compare, qualify, and convert at once. Creating one page for every wording variation would create the opposite problem: multiple thin pages serving the same task. The map protects against both extremes.
7. The mapped decision constrains the page brief
Once a cluster has an owner, the content brief inherits the map rather than reopening the routing decision. Carry forward:
- the exact page decision statement;
- the direct answer or primary interaction needed early;
- the evidence and subquestions required to support the decision;
- the terminology that needs disambiguation;
- the page format and why the result evidence supports it;
- what the page deliberately excludes;
- the next action and where it leads; and
- the uncertainty and review trigger.
This is the point where page type becomes useful. A guide, comparison, tool, category, or landing page is a delivery mechanism for the decision—not the decision itself. If a planned format cannot carry the required proof or interaction, change the format. Do not weaken the page job to preserve a familiar template.
Keep the CTA proportionate to the task. A definition page that interrupts the answer with a hard sales gate has not completed the informational job. A commercial comparison that hides limitations cannot support a responsible choice. A transactional page that withholds the conditions of the action creates friction at exactly the moment the query asks to act.
8. Observed performance tests page ownership
After publication or a material update, compare the map with what Search Console reports. For each priority cluster, ask:
- Is the intended page receiving impressions for the expected query family?
- Are unexpected pages appearing for the same task?
- Are two same-intent pages repeatedly exchanging ownership?
- Does the result snippet accurately represent the page decision?
- Are new query variants exposing a missing subquestion or a different task?
- Does on-site behavior show that visitors can complete the mapped next action?
Interpret visibility changes against a dated observation and the competing causes: the result landscape, competitors, demand, indexing, or the page itself. Google Search Console similarly warns that page changes and performance changes can coincide without proving that one caused the other.
Update the map when evidence changes. Useful triggers include a durable shift in result types, a product or information-architecture change, a new page repeatedly appearing for the cluster, a same-intent ownership conflict, or a mapped page becoming unable to support its promised decision.
The final quality gate determines whether content can enter production
Run the completed map through a short review:
- Every cluster has a specific page decision or an explicit no-target reason.
- Every target page has one primary exit decision, even when it serves many related queries.
- Query wording, tool labels, live result evidence, and editorial inference are distinguishable.
- Mixed intent remains visible rather than being forced into false certainty.
- Existing pages were checked before a new URL was approved.
- Potential overlap is supported by same-intent and performance evidence, not duplicate words alone.
- The page format can deliver the required evidence or interaction.
- The next action follows naturally from the completed search task.
- An owner and review trigger are recorded.
